Canadian-Made Products ๐ท๏ธ๐จ๐ฆ (More than) 100 Canadian Games for the Nintendo Switch
Last year, I posted this spreadsheet of Nintendo Switch (and Switch 2) games that have a Canadian developer and/or publisher. Since posting, I've made some improvements to the document, most notably adding a script to automatically check for discounts. So, in light recent events, I thought it was a good time to repost it.
I'm happy to say 7 of 10 provinces are now represented (I'm still looking for games from Manitoba, NB, and PEI, as well as the territories--send any leads my way!).
Note that the list is a work in progress and does not yet include Canadian-developed games that are published by US-based companies (e.g., Tunic). Also, I should clarify that the links to the eShop store in the document are not affiliate links. I'm not trying to make money off this list.

Review ๐ข Buy ARIZER vaporizers.
Iโll throw a plug in for this company. Used to live the same city and knew people who worked there. Good to see theyโre still going strong.
Reasonable prices, definitely quality products, they sell a LOT to USA and Europe so losing USA as a market likely hurts.
Iโve found them second to none in service. After 5 or more years with the extreme I had a problem with it , I think it was likely my mistake, anyway they fixed it for me and sent me a free gift for the inconvenience, all I had to do was pay to ship it there. Who does that any more?
Anyway I think they make better vaporizers than the American designed stuff and Iโve personally had better service than American branded vapes because when I did buy vapes from the US they either ignored me or wanted so much money for repairs or exchange it wasnโt worth it.
Thatโs my plug for a good Canadian company with good products and good service that deserves some support.
